Let’s start at the beginning. Gamete formation is the first order of business. Imagine this as the “pre-production phase” of a movie where sperm and egg cells are created through a special kind of cell division called meiosis. It’s not just any division; it’s a process that ensures genetic diversity. Kind of like casting different actors for varied roles in a play. The more varied, the more interesting, right?

Next, we move on to fertilization, where magic meets science. This is when a sperm cell (one half of our biological duo) unites with an egg cell. Picture it as a grand reveal at a wedding, where two entities say, “I do” to form a brand-new entity called a zygote. This union doesn’t just combine genetic material; it kicks off an exciting journey towards creating a new organism. You can see why this part is so essential!

Now, what happens next? Buckle up! This zygote doesn’t just sit there—oh no. It begins to develop through various stages, growing and morphing into what will eventually become a new organism. This development is like an artist sculpting a masterpiece, where every detail matters. The way cells divide and differentiate is crucial; they’re like fabric woven together to create something beautiful and unique.

To put it all in order—here’s the sequence you need to remember: first, we form gametes (that’s the sperm and egg), next comes the fertilization of those gametes to produce a zygote, and finally, that zygote embarks on a transformation journey to become a new organism. Your answer is B→C→A→D.
